Lonely

We were so lonely we were so small we were so young we didn't know we tried to live we tried to grow walking the streets on our own... We were so lonely we were so clean we didn't know why we were here we needed a hand or someone near to help us go through the years... We were so lonely there was no God to hear our prayers to hear our words to dry our tears to hold our souls we were just lonely that's all. Jessica
